改善子宫内膜微生物群对体外受精结果的影响

概括
在体外受精 (IVF) 患者中恢复健康的子宫微生物群,其中乳酸菌占主导地位,可以改善妊娠结果. 特定的Lactobacillus物种影响成功,有针对性的治疗提供生殖益处.

背景情况:
- 子宫微生物组在生殖健康和怀孕成功方面发挥着至关重要的作用.
- 子宫内膜微生物组的失调或失衡越来越多地与不孕症和体外受精 (IVF) 的不良结果有关.
- 乳酸菌种是健康的阴道和子宫环境的关键组成部分,但它们在试管婴儿结果中的特定作用需要进一步阐明.
研究的目的:
- 用下一代测序 (NGS) 来分析IVF患者的子宫微生物组合.
- 调查乳杆菌物种,特别是乳杆菌内置物对怀孕结果的影响.
- 评估抗生素治疗在调节子宫内膜微生物组和提高试管婴儿成功率方面的疗效.
主要方法:
- 对257名试管婴儿患者进行了子宫内膜微生物组测试.
- 根据Lactobacillus spp.患者被分类为乳杆菌主导微生物组 (LDM) 和非LDM组. 它们的丰富性 (>90%).
- 非LDM患者接受了治疗,并且在治疗后组中分析了那些显示改善的患者.
主要成果:
- 乳酸菌在许多试管婴儿患者中占主导地位,但有些人表现出与细菌性阴道炎相关的细菌.
- 治疗改善了81.4%的非LDM患者的微生物组,导致怀孕成功率与LDM组相似.
- 乳杆菌crispatus和乳杆菌gasseri与积极的妊娠结果有关,而高丰度的乳杆菌iners (≥74.2%) 与较低的成功率相关.
结论:
- 在非LDM试管婴儿患者中恢复LDM可以增强子宫内膜微生物组合和妊娠结果.
- 乳酸菌的特定物种对于试管婴儿的成功至关重要;高水平的乳酸菌与减少怀孕率有关.
- 有针对性的微生物干预措施有望改善试管婴儿患者的生殖结果.

In Vitro Fertilization
845
In vitro fertilization (IVF) is a form of assisted reproductive technology where an egg is fertilized with sperm in a controlled laboratory environment before transferring the resulting embryo into the uterus. This process is designed to help individuals and couples experiencing difficulties conceiving.

Infertility in Females
3.6K
Female infertility is defined as the inability to conceive after a year of regular, unprotected intercourse and affects about 10–15% of couples worldwide. The primary cause of female infertility is ovulatory disorders, which hinder the release of eggs. These disorders can be classified as hypothalamic amenorrhea, polycystic ovarian syndrome (PCOS), premature ovarian failure, and hyperprolactinemic anovulation disorders.
